
Erin Bradham focuses her practice on commercial litigation and complex insurance coverage and bad faith actions. She defends major insurance companies in disputes involving all types of insurance coverage, including homeowners, commercial liability, disability, medical malpractice, builders risk, and automobile coverages.
Erin also represents hospitals, laboratories, and physician groups in contract disputes. She has extensive experience defending clients in both state and federal courts, including as trial counsel in a recent two-week jury trial that resulted in a defense verdict.
Erin is also very committed to pro bono service. She has successfully secured asylum and other immigration relief for more than a dozen clients fleeing political persecution or harm in their home country.
